I have a strange problem. I am using NT4sp6a and have a domain that several computers use to log in to. We have one account (one, as far as I can tell) that when we log out of it it will remove the directory it created in "Documents in Settings". This of course means that all settings where lost. All other accounts seem to be acting normally. Nothing seems out of the ordinary for that account and I cannot see anything in eventvwr on the client and server computers. I have tried this on 3 computers so far and get the same results everytime. There has not been anything done to the server that would cause this to happen as far as I know. I've asked everybody with access if they made any changes and they have not.

I have discovered that if I give the domain account admin access under "control panel > Users" this does not happen. I would not like to give everybody admin access to the machine so less spyware/adware junk will get on the machine.

If anybody has any insight or somewhere else to investigate this I would greatly appreciate it. If you'd like more info let me know.
